WebMar 21, 2024 · Applies to: SQL Server Azure SQL Managed Instance. At a minimum, every SQL Server database has two operating system files: a data file and a log file. Data files contain data and objects such as tables, indexes, stored procedures, and views. Log files contain the information that is required to recover all transactions in the database. WebJun 24, 2024 · 5. Tagged image file format (TIFF or TIF) A TIFF file is a high-quality image file type. You may use this file type when scanning documents, using a desktop publisher program or printing high-quality items. For example, if you are publishing a marketing pamphlet, you may upload TIFF files for the photographs. WebShapefiles are one of the most common file formats for geospatial data. They store data as points, lines, or polygons. These three feature types form the basis of geospatial vector data analysis. Points can be used to represent addresses, points of interest, and parcel or ZIP Code centroids.
